Можно ли передавать переменные через контекст выполнения?
Можете объяснить иерархию сообщений с гарантией доставки, при которой сообщение гарантированно будет доставлено хотя бы один раз?
Почему важно устанавливать таймаут при выполнении HTTP-запросов?
Какой у вас ожидаемый диапазон заработной платы?
Каковы преимущества и недостатки использования тайм-аутов для завершения горутин в Go?
Чем отличается параллельная обработка задач от многопоточного выполнения в программировании?
В чем преимущества использования горутин по сравнению с системными потоками для повышения производительности приложений?
Опиши ситуацию, в которой использование контекстов было бы оправдано и эффективно.
Для чего используют пустые структуры данных в программировании?
Что происходит, если создать слайс с нулевым значением и какие операции с ним допустимы?
Когда в программировании интерфейс может иметь значение nil или быть неопределенным?
Какова роль и важность установки тайм-аутов в сетевых соединениях?
Можете объяснить концепцию sync.Pool и как он помогает управлять памятью в Go?
Каким образом обрабатывать ситуации, когда Map еще не была инициализирована?
Каким образом продюсер решает, в какую партицию направить данные для записи?
Можете объяснить, что такое руна в языке программирования Go?
Каковы основные задачи и преимущества использования репликации в системах хранения данных?
Как создать пустой или нулевой слайс в языке программирования?
Каким образом синхронизировать доступ к общему ресурсу с помощью структуры Map и механизма Mutex?
Каким образом можно обеспечить пригодность операций к повторному выполнению без негативных последствий?